Softball Falls In Nightcap, Splits Series With Flagler

PEMBROKE – Visiting Flagler registered five hits in a key 4-run first inning and held off a late charge by the UNC Pembroke softball team to register an 8-4 win in the series finale and forge a Saturday split at LRA Field.

The setback snapped a five-game win streak for UNCP (22-22, 8-12 PBC) who will play the final two games of the regular season on Sunday against 12th-ranked Armstrong Atlantic (26-11, 11-6). Hoping to attain one of eight berths for next weekend's Peach Belt Conference Tournament, the Braves need at least a split with the Pirates to keep itself alive for the final invite. Flagler (25-25, 11-9) has now won six of its last eight contests.

The Braves got base hits from seven different players, including all-American Brea Hartley who turned in a 3-for-4 outing with a run scored. Megan Hillard tripled and walked twice to key a 1-for-3 day at the plate, while Karlee Wilson (2-for-3) singled twice on three trips to the plate.

Flagler got home runs from both Melanie Oliver and Molly Whittington. Three different players, including Whittington, tallied two hits apiece for the Saints.

Selena Ashley (11-11) took the loss for the Black & Gold after allowing eight runs (six earned) on 11 hits and five walks, while also striking out four. Katelynn Smith (6-8) picked up the win for the visitors despite surrendering four earned runs on 10 hits and three walks.

Flagler used a leadoff homer from Whittington to pad its lead out to 5-0 in the fifth, but the Braves cut into their deficit with three runs in the bottom of the sixth to get back into the game. Oliver led off the seventh with a solo shot off the wall in centerfield, and the Saints pushed their advantage back out to five runs by crossing the plate twice following two costly errors by the Pembroke defense.

Taylor Cloninger's run scoring single with two outs in the bottom of the seventh would provide the final.

Sunday's doubleheader with the nationally-ranked Pirates will be preceded by Senior Day festivities at LRA Field. UNCP will honor its four-member senior class – Katy Austin, Cloninger, Shelby Holland and Natalie Klemann – prior to the 1 p.m. first pitch.
